Tottenham face Watford at Vicarage Road on Saturday.

Spurs have gone three games without achieving maximum points and now sit nine points away from the top four in eighth place.

Jose Mourinho’s side are in need of a win, but with players such as Harry Kane out with injury they may struggle to achieve this.

Since the take-over of Nigel Pearson following the sacking of Javi Gracia and Quique Sanchez Flores Watford have had four victories from their last five Premier League games.

Last time out, a 3-0 win away to Bournemouth saw the Hornets break out the relegation zone for the first time this season.

Team news

Tottenham

Gedson Fernandes has joined Tottenham on an 18 month loan from Benfica.

Moussa Sissoko will be out of action for some time after has undergoing surgery to rectify a knee injury which he picked up in Spurs 1-0 defeat to Southampton on New Year’s Day.

Harry Kane will also not be making an appearance after picking up a hamstring injury at Southampton on New Years Day.

The striker will be out for around three months as he recovers from surgery.

Hugo Lloris and Ben Davis are also out with injuries.

Watford

Watford made their first signing of the transfer window early this week with Ignacio Pussetto joining from Udinese for £6.8m.

The 24 year old forward has been with Udinese since 2018.

Christian Kasasele will not be making an appearance due to suspension after picing up a red card against wolves.

Will Hughes & Daryl Janmaat could be in line for a return to the substitute bench

Official line-ups

Tottenham: Gazzaniga, Aurier, Alderweireld, Vertonghen (C), Tanganga, Winks, Lo Celso, Dele, Lamela, Son, Lucas

Watford: Foster, Masina, Cathcart, Dawson, Mariappa, Capoue, Chalobah, Deulofeu, Doucoure, Sarr, Deeney​
